Transaction 3033562908cad6dabe02bbb9736f29a82082fb69299227904a8a39b05c2b375e

2 Input
2 Outputs
  • 3033562908cad6dabe02bbb9736f29a82082fb69299227904a8a39b05c2b375e:0
  • value  68860
    address  15ELdytuaYXcEXsTKUsCEk4nBF6Feh5HVf
  • 3033562908cad6dabe02bbb9736f29a82082fb69299227904a8a39b05c2b375e:1
  • value  20000000
    address  18v8LhTzsJZ7bnWy2rFL2NmmfMUvcanqVi